Management of Subcentimeter Thyroid Nodule with Punctate Calcification
For this 0.3 cm cystic thyroid nodule with punctate calcification, observation with surveillance ultrasound is the appropriate next step rather than immediate fine-needle aspiration biopsy. 1
Rationale for Surveillance Over Immediate FNA
While punctate (micro)calcifications are highly specific for papillary thyroid carcinoma and typically mandate tissue diagnosis regardless of nodule size 1, current evidence-based guidelines create an important exception for nodules <1 cm to prevent overdiagnosis of clinically insignificant papillary microcarcinomas that do not impact mortality or quality of life. 2, 3, 4
Key Decision Points
Size threshold: FNA should be considered for nodules ≤10 mm diameter only when suspicious ultrasound signs are present AND high-risk clinical factors coexist (history of head/neck irradiation, family history of thyroid cancer, suspicious cervical lymphadenopathy, age <15 years, subcapsular location). 3, 1
Cystic composition: This nodule is predominantly cystic (0.3 x 0.1 x 0.3 cm with peripheral calcification), and cystic nodules carry significantly lower malignancy risk compared to solid nodules—the malignancy rate for partially cystic thyroid nodules ranges from 3.3-17.6%. 5
Clinical context matters: The absence of high-risk clinical features (no mention of prior radiation, family history, suspicious lymph nodes, or compressive symptoms) supports conservative management. 1
Recommended Surveillance Protocol
Initial follow-up ultrasound at 12 months to assess for interval growth or development of additional suspicious features. 2, 3
Define significant growth as an increase of ≥3 mm in any dimension, which would trigger cytological evaluation regardless of baseline size. 2
Assess for new suspicious features at each surveillance visit: marked hypoechogenicity, irregular margins, loss of peripheral halo, central hypervascularity, or enlargement of the solid component. 2, 1
Evaluate cervical lymph nodes systematically at each ultrasound to detect suspicious features (loss of fatty hilum, microcalcifications, cystic change, abnormal vascularity). 1
When to Proceed to FNA
Trigger FNA if any of the following develop during surveillance:
- Growth ≥3 mm in any dimension 2
- Development of additional high-risk ultrasound features (solid component enlargement, marked hypoechogenicity, irregular margins) 2, 1
- New suspicious cervical lymphadenopathy 1
- Compressive symptoms (dysphagia, dyspnea, voice changes) 2
- Discovery of high-risk clinical factors (family history, prior radiation exposure) 1
Critical Pitfalls to Avoid
Do not perform FNA solely based on the presence of punctate calcifications in nodules <1 cm without high-risk clinical factors, as this leads to overdiagnosis and unnecessary thyroidectomies for papillary microcarcinomas that have excellent prognosis with observation alone. 2, 3, 4
Do not rely on TSH levels or thyroid function tests to assess malignancy risk, as most thyroid cancers present with normal thyroid function. 2
Do not order radionuclide scanning in euthyroid patients, as it does not add value for malignancy risk assessment in this clinical scenario. 2
Recognize that false-negative FNA results occur in 5-11% of cases, so if high clinical suspicion develops during surveillance despite benign cytology, repeat FNA or surgical consultation may be warranted. 2, 1
Special Considerations for Cystic Nodules
If the nodule enlarges and becomes symptomatic during surveillance, simple aspiration of internal fluid can serve as both diagnostic and therapeutic intervention, with 40.8% of predominantly cystic nodules showing significant size reduction after aspiration. 6
For recurrent cystic lesions after aspiration, percutaneous ethanol injection should be considered as first-line treatment rather than surgery. 7
Documentation Requirements
Measure and document all three dimensions of the nodule at each surveillance visit to accurately detect the 3 mm growth threshold. 2
Systematically document the percentage of cystic versus solid components, as management may change if the solid portion enlarges. 5
Record the exact location of calcifications (peripheral rim versus internal microcalcifications), as this distinction affects malignancy risk stratification. 1, 5
